This article provides some new construction methods of partially balanced bipartite block (PBBB) designs for comparing test treatments with more than one control. Partially balanced incomplete block (PBIB) designs based on some association schemes such as triangular association, Latin-square association, group divisible association, and cyclic association are used for developing these methods of construction. A catalog of efficient PBBB designs is included for parameter values v1 (number of test treatments) ≤10, v2 (number of control treatments) =2,b (number of blocks) ≤8,r1 (replications of test treatments) ≤10 and k (block size) ≤6 along with computed variances.
